在处理大量文档时,我们经常需要对图片进行批量操作,例如统一大小、格式或者删除等,Word作为常用的办公软件,提供了一些工具和方法来帮助我们高效地完成这些任务,本文将详细介绍如何在Word中批量选择和编辑图片,以及一些实用的技巧和注意事项。
准备工作
在进行批量操作之前,请确保你的Word版本支持宏功能(如Office 2013及以上版本),如果不确定,可以通过以下步骤检查:
![word怎么批量选图片](/d/file/p/2025/01-03/ba6b2c07f34c55fc9630b88a055ddc11.png)
1、打开Word文档。
2、点击“文件” > “选项”。
3、在弹出的对话框中选择“信任中心”,然后点击右侧的“信任中心设置”。
4、在信任中心设置窗口中,选择“宏设置”,并确认启用了所有宏(不建议关闭此选项)。
使用宏批量选择图片
1. 录制新宏
按下Alt + F11
进入VBA编辑器。
![word怎么批量选图片](/d/file/p/2025/01-03/18e46719cf859c21449e7ed2f19f23f3.jpeg)
在左侧的项目资源管理器中找到你的文档名称,右键点击它,选择“插入” > “模块”。
在新创建的模块中输入以下代码:
```vba
Sub SelectAllImages()
Dim doc As Document
Set doc = ActiveDocument
![word怎么批量选图片](/d/file/p/2025/01-03/79aad60805c9f6009b8a78290d6b3db5.jpeg)
Dim inlineShape As InlineShape
For Each inlineShape In doc.InlineShapes
If inlineShape.Type = wdInlineShapePicture Then
inlineShape.Select
End If
Next inlineShape
End Sub
```
关闭VBA编辑器,返回Word文档。
2. 运行宏
按Alt + F8
打开宏对话框。
在下拉列表中找到刚刚创建的宏SelectAllImages
,选中它并点击“运行”。
现在你应该能够看到文档中的所有图片都被选中了。
批量编辑图片
一旦所有图片被选中,你就可以开始进行各种批量编辑操作了,以下是几个常见的例子:
1. 调整图片大小
确保所有图片仍处于选中状态。
转到“图片工具”选项卡(当您选择了一张图片时会出现)。
在“大小”组中输入所需的宽度和高度值,或者使用百分比来缩放图片。
按下回车键应用更改到所有选定的图片。
2. 更改图片样式
同样地,在“图片工具”选项卡下,你可以更改边框、阴影、反射等效果。
选择一个预设样式或自定义设置,然后应用到所有选定的图片上。
3. 删除图片
如果需要删除所有选中的图片,只需按Delete
键即可完成操作。
注意事项与技巧
备份原始文件:在进行任何批量修改之前,最好先保存一份副本以防万一出现问题。
测试小范围:对于不熟悉的操作,建议先在一个较小的样本上试验以确保结果符合预期。
利用快捷键:熟悉并利用快捷键可以大大提高工作效率,比如使用Ctrl + A
快速全选当前页面内容。
定期清理未使用对象:有时候文档里可能包含许多不再需要的对象,定期清理可以帮助保持文档整洁且减少不必要的干扰。
相关问答FAQs
Q1: 如何撤销对图片所做的更改?
A1: 如果你不小心做出了错误的更改,可以使用Ctrl + Z
撤销最近一次的操作;如果想要完全恢复到最初状态,则需要手动重新调整每张图片的属性。
Q2: 是否可以只针对特定类型的图片执行批量操作?
A2: 是的,通过修改上述宏代码中的条件语句,你可以指定只处理特定类型的图片(例如仅处理JPEG格式),具体做法是在循环体内添加额外的判断逻辑来实现这一点。
各位小伙伴们,我刚刚为大家分享了有关word怎么批量选图片的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!
内容摘自:https://news.huochengrm.cn/zcjh/12029.html